To renew or not renew annual travel insurance

peterwhit
Posts: 3 Newbie

Our annual policy expires 13 April 2020. We have two holidays planned in June 2020 that were booked before FCO advice was issued to not travel to the destinations (due to Corona virus). My belief is that the event that would lead to cancellation was the FCO initial issue date of advice to not travel. Therefore I believe we are covered by insurance if the holiday gets cancelled after 13 April i.e. if the previously issued FCO advice remains in place.
However LV are insisting I renew in case the advice changes. This is extortion as the insurable event has surely occurred already.

The FCO advice not to travel was given on 17th March, for 30 days. Technically your holiday stands unaffected, and your insurers will hang on to this. You'll have to play the waiting game, or have reason to claim for another insurable reason in the meantime.
If you switch your insurance to another provider, you'll lose the cover for coronavirus related claims you currently have. If I were you I'd extend the cover, unless your holiday providers cancel the holidays first.0 -
